Frankie Frisch Reach Bat Value Assistance Requested
My Dad found this bat at a garage sale and asked me to help him find some information about what it is and what it is not. (That translates to "Here, Sonny, sell this for me!")
Anyway, it is an uncracked Block Letter Frankie Frisch Reach "Player's Model" bat, ~34" long and weighing ~36 ounces. Excellent overall condition, no missing pieces, no splits, no gouges, no repairs. I ASSUME that it is a Store Model. Any information that you would be willing to share regarding the bat's value (or lack thereof) would be greatly appreciated.
